Muse, St. Vincent Cover Nirvana’s ‘Lithium’

This past Saturday marked the 20th anniversary of Kurt Cobain‘s untimely death and amongst the many tributes were those from fellow artists, paying homage to the musical legacy the Nirvana frontman helped create. Two such artists were space rockers Muse and indie darling St. Vincent who each delivered a cover of the grunge standard Lithium.

“Someone great died 20 years ago. This next song is for Kurt Cobain,” Muse frontman Matthew Bellamy announced during their headlining set at Lollapalooza in Sao Paulo, Brazil, before launching into a blistering crowd sing-along of the Nevermind track.

Similarly, in another part of the globe, art-rock impressionist St Vincent, also delivered a scorching version of the grunge anthem, paying a fitting tribute to the late Nirvana frontman during her concert in Chicago.
